    Breakaway Speed

    So just wondering what everyone's opinion on this was.

    In my opinion, there has been a lack of that breakaway speed factor in NCAA the last two games.
    The fact that acceleration plays into the way players move now is a bonus, but i feel like I have guys with high top end speed getting caught from behind ALLLLLL THE TIME in the open field.

    I liked how in NCAA09, if a player was a burner, you better keep him in front of you. Now, there were farrrrrr too many players that were extremely fast in 09, and it ruined the balance. But it seems like they have overcompensated for that the past two years to me. There should still be players with game breaking speed. I just haven't seen it no matter what their SPD and ACC ratings are.

    Should be added that this is especially true on heisman....but that's how it's always been haha
